Output 8d2c670cd89423c98bdb7b09b520834b5da85a6c773c61f3eeb08a181b11fa35:17

value
60691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ec5ade9797c80442b9690da0fed7daddf04fbe30 OP_EQUAL
address
3PEkFYEY63WFocWRbtC5LUD5HCKPSRx3ry
transaction
8d2c670cd89423c98bdb7b09b520834b5da85a6c773c61f3eeb08a181b11fa35
confirmations
118
spent
true